(Baltimore, MD) -- Maryland is bracing for a big ice storm.
Patchy ice is in the forecast in Baltimore this evening through late Thursday night, with slicker conditions further north and west.
An Ice Storm Warning is issued for Garrett and Allegany counties.
Ice Storm Warnings and Winter Weather Advisories have been issued. Significant icing is likely along and west of the Blue Ridge tonight through Thursday. Ice amounts of 0.25-0.75" are expected. Further east, up to 0.10" of ice is expected north & west of I-95. pic.twitter.com/RamBGLy4gN

The western part of the state is also expecting gusty winds of about 45 miles per hour.
Folks should plan for road closures and delays.
